What is Sandbox MCP Server?

Sandbox MCP Server is a Docker-based code execution environment server that allows users to run code, install software packages, and configure development environments in fully isolated containers without affecting the host system.

How to use Sandbox MCP Server?

Through Claude Desktop integration or direct API calls, you can create containers, execute code, save the environment state, and generate reusable Docker configurations.

Use cases

Suitable for scenarios that require secure execution of unknown code, rapid setup of temporary development environments, teaching demonstrations, or automated testing that requires environment isolation.

Main features

Container management
Create, start, and stop containers of any Docker image
Multi-language support
Support code execution in multiple programming languages such as Python, C, and Java
Environment persistence
Save the configured environment as a Docker image or generate a Dockerfile
Package management
Install various software packages and dependencies inside the container
Security isolation
All code is executed in fully isolated containers without affecting the host system
Advantages
Fully isolated execution environment to ensure host security
Support for rapid setup and destruction of development environments
Environment configurations can be saved and reused
No need to install various language environments locally
Seamless integration with Claude Desktop
Limitations
Requires Docker environment support
Container performance may be slightly lower than the native environment
Limited support for graphical interface applications
Requires a certain network bandwidth to pull Docker images
